FMXMBS2118GEA-15.000000M Overview

Parallel - Fundamental Quartz Crystal, 15MHz Nom, HC-49/US, SMD, 2 PIN

FMXMBS2118GEA-15.000000M Parametric

Parameter NameAttribute value
Is it lead-free?Lead free
Is it Rohs certified?conform to
Objectid1311726252
package instructionHC-49/US, SMD, 2 PIN
Reach Compliance Codecompliant
Ageing5 PPM/YEAR
Crystal/Resonator TypePARALLEL - FUNDAMENTAL
Drive level1000 µW
frequency stability0.0015%
frequency tolerance25 ppm
load capacitance18 pF
Installation featuresSURFACE MOUNT
Nominal operating frequency15 MHz
Maximum operating temperature70 °C
Minimum operating temperature
physical sizeL11.5XB5.0XH3.2 (mm)/L0.453XB0.197XH0.126 (inch)
Series resistance40 Ω
